The 2021 season kicked off last week in the middle of the week, a Wednesday for the WTA (Abu Dhabi) and a Thursday for the ATP (Delray Beach and Antalya).

This is one of the first originalities of a cover unlike any other.

The return to normal on the world circuit, it is not yet for now… But, at least, the little yellow ball does not disappear from the radars as it had been the case for five months in 2020, a historic year notably marked by the cancellation of Wimbledon - a first since World War II.

At the start of the year, the actors and actresses of the game can exercise their profession under (almost) normal conditions.

Finally, according to the normality of the world under Covid-19… Sunday began the qualifications for the Australian Open, bringing together players classified between the 100th and 250th places in the world, played until January 13 in… the Emirates.

In Doha, Qatar, for men and Dubai for women!

Unheard of, obviously.
